Skoda Fabia 1.4 8v G62 fault

Featured Replies

Engine management light came on my sis's 2001 fabia the other day so i hooked it up to VAG-COM:

16502 engine coolant temp sensor (g62): signal too high

p0118 - 35-10 intermittent

17549 P1141 Load Calculation Cross Check Range/Performance

Now I see on here lots of 1.8T engines having the G62 fault - but no 1.4s. Is it the same fault?

Can anyone tell me the part number for the G62 sensor on this car - is it 06A919501 ??? all i could find on Etka.

I take it the 2nd error is due to the first - or are they unrelated? Cheers.

Anyway i changed the above sensor and all is well. £27 inc the seal from Skoda dealer, which is a complete rip off as the same thing for my Mk2 Golf GTI is £6.

Dead easy to change - whip the engine cover off (2 bolts) and it is staring you in the face. Pull the plastic C clip off and the sensor pulls out easily.
